Soludo condemns attack on Senator Ifeanyi Ubah

Governor of Anambra State, Prof. Charles Soludo

Anambra State Governor, Prof. Charles Soludo, has condemned the attack on the Senator representing Anambra South Senatorial District, Dr Patrick Ifeanyi Ubah by gunmen.

The senator’s convoy was reportedly attacked on Sunday evening by gunmen and some of his personal aides and an unconfirmed number of persons were killed.

In the report, Ifeanyi Ubah narrowly escaped his assailants who attacked his convoy at the Enugwu-Ukwu road in Njikoka Local Government Area of Anambra State

Condemning the attack, Soludo in a statement issued by his Press Secretary, Mr Christian Aburime, said the government was fully determined to wipe out every act of criminality in the State.

According to him, “this is the last ditched-effort of a sinking boat” by these criminal elements

He reassured that all security agencies in the state are now on full alert to fish out the perpetrators of this heinous attack. The governor further noted that the attackers of the senator would be made to face the full wrath of the law when apprehended.

The Governor also commiserated with the families of the senator’s aides who lost their lives as well as the State Commissioner of Police, for the policemen who also lost their lives.
